Standard Controllers (cont‟d)
Note: If one or more controllers are installed, at least one must be ON for the water heater
to operate. If all controllers are OFF the water heater will only deliver cold water.
Selectable Temperatures:
Kitchen Controller:
37, 38, 39, 40, 41, 42, 43, 44, 45, 46, 47, 48, 50*, 55*, 60°C*
Bathroom Controllers:
37, 38, 39, 40, 41, 42, 43, 44, 45, 46, 47, 48, 50°C*
* Temperatures above 48°C are not available on controllers fitted to 246, 276, 876 series
models as these units have a maximum selectable temperature of 48°C at all locations.
ON / OFF button
This button must be pressed once to turn on the controller. The
light in the button will glow when the controller is on. A
controller cannot be turned on if water is flowing from a hot tap.
To turn off a controller, press the on / off button once. The light
will go out. A controller can be turned off whilst water is flowing.
Priority light
This light will glow on a controller when that controller has
priority. The Bathroom controller(s), if they are turned on, have
priority over the Kitchen controller. Priority means that controller
has control of the water heater temperature setting. The water
temperature setting can only be adjusted by the controller that
has priority.
In use light
This light will glow on all controllers, whether they are on or off,
when hot water is flowing, regardless of which controller has
priority.
Display panel
The current temperature setting is displayed on all controllers
(whether hot water is flowing or not), when any controller is on.
If all controllers are off, then the display remains blank. The
water volume can also be displayed on the Kitchen controller.
The x10l symbol glows when the water volume is displayed.
(up button)
The up button increases the temperature setting.
(down button)
The down button decreases the temperature setting.
water volume button
(Kitchen controller only) This feature enables an alarm to
sound when a set volume of water has flowed through the water
heater (refer to notes below).
Water volume notes:
The water volume function is designed to warn, by a beeping sound, that a certain
volume of water has been delivered from the water heater. It does not stop either the
flow of or the heating of water.
